Loan Specialist
Summary This position is based within the Office of the Under Secretary of Defense for Research and Engineering (OUSD(R&E)), in the Office of Strategic Capital (OSC). The Under Secretary of Defense for Research and Engineering (USD(R&E)) serves as the Chief Technology Officer (CTO). This role involves driving the department's efforts in research, development, and prototyping. The Office of Strategic Capital (OSC) plays a vital role in advancing strategic financial initiatives. Responsibilities Incumbent typical work assignments may include the following: Cultivating and maintaining relationships with interagency partners to support program objectives and accelerate OSC's mission implementation. Managing the underwriting process to originate, structure, and execute loans and guarantees for investment fund leverage, corporate finance, asset-based, and project finance transactions in covered technology areas. Developing financial models and term sheets for debenture instruments involving investment fund leverage, including creating complex financial covenants. Managing credit risks associated with loans and guarantees across corporate finance, asset-based, and project finance transactions in key technology sectors. Requirements Conditions of Employment Qualifications Basic Requirement Education Undergraduate and Graduate Education: Major study -- finance, business administration, economics, accounting, insurance, engineering, mathematics, banking and credit, law, real estate operations, statistics, or other fields related to the position, such as agriculture, agricultural economics, farm, livestock or ranch management, or rural sociology. or Experience General Experience (for GS-5 positions): Experience that required gathering and analyzing facts and figures, and presenting the information or conclusions in clear oral and written language; or that provided a knowledge of the principles of financial analysis or of insurance laws, such as contract, property, life, casualty, or marine insurance. Specialized Experience (for positions above GS-5): Experience that demonstrated competence in agricultural, commercial, realty, or other types of loans. Experience may have been gained in such work as reviewing and passing upon applications for agricultural, commercial, bank or mortgage loans; servicing a loan portfolio of a bank or other loan association; performing financial analysis of commercial concerns for investment purposes; appraising real estate to determine property valuation; or similar work. Time in Grade: For entry at the NH-04 level, status applicants must have served 52 weeks as a NH-03 (or GS equivalent) or higher grade in the Federal Service. Specialized Experience: For the NH-4, you must have at least one year of specialized experience equivalent in level of difficulty and responsibility to the NH-3 grade level in the Federal service, or comparable in difficulty and responsibility to NH-3 if outside the Federal service. Specialized experience is defined as...experience assisting with negotiations with potential borrowers, developing financial models to assist with risk management, and assisting with the development of financial risk management policies. In addition to meeting the specialized experience requirements, qualified applicants must also possess the quality of experience as it relates to how closely or to what extent an applicant's background, recency of experience, education, and training are relevant to the duties and responsibilities of the announced position. Candidates must clearly demonstrate the possession of competencies necessary to successfully perform the work of the position at the appropriate level to be qualified for the position. Applicants must describe how their experience meets the competencies within the body of the resume. No separate statements addressing competencies are required. Competencies: Negotiation, Principles of Finance, and Risk Management Qualification and time-in-grade requirements must be met at the closing date of this announcement.
